Let `z in C` and if `A={z:"arg"(z)=pi/4}`and `B={z:"arg"(z-3-3i)=(2pi)/3}`. Then `n(A frown B)=`

A

`1`

B

`2`

C

`3`

D

`0`

Text Solution

Verified by Experts

The correct Answer is:
D

`(d)` `A={z,arg(z)=(pi)/(4)}`
`z` lies on the ray from origin (excluding origin) at an angle `pi//4` with positive real axis.
`B ={z,arg(z-3-3i)=(2pi)/(3)}`
`z` lies on the ray from `3+3i`(excluding `3+3i`) at an angle `2pi//3` with positive real axis.

We can observe that `3+3i in A` but `ne B`
`:.n(AnnB)=0`
